INSPECTION PROCEDURE

1

PERFORM ACTIVE TEST BY OBD II SCAN TOOL OR HAND-HELD TESTER

(a)

Warm up the engine.

(b)

Turn the ignition switch OFF.

(c)

Connect the OBD II scan tool or Hand-held tester to the DLC3.

(d)

Turn the ignition switch ON and push the OBD II scan tool or Hand-held tester main SW ON.

(e)

Select the item ”SHIFT” in the ACTIVE TEST and operate the shift solenoid valves on the OBD II scan
tool or Hand-held tester.

NOTICE:
The values given below for ”Normal Condition” are representative values, so a vehicle may still be
normal even if its value differs from those listed here. Do not depend solely on the ”Normal Condi-
tion” here when deciding whether or not the part is faulty.

Item

Test Details

Diagnostic Note

SHIFT

[Test Details]
Operate the shift solenoid valve and set the each shift position by your-
self.
[Vehicle Condition]
Less than 50 km/h (31 mph)
[Others]

Press

button: Shift up

Press

button: Shift down

Possible to check the operation of

the shift solenoid values.

2

INSPECT TRANSMISSION WIRE(SL1/SL2/SL3)

(a)

Disconnect the 2 transmission wire connectors from the
transaxle.

(b)

Measure the resistance between terminals SL1+ and
SL1-.
OK:
Resistance: 5.0 - 5.6

at 20

C (68

F)

NG(A)

Go to step 5

(c)

Measure the resistance between terminals SL2+ and
SL2-.
OK:
Resistance: 5.0 - 5.6

at 20

C (68

F)

NG(B)

Go to step 6

(d)

Measure the resistance between terminals SL3+ and
SL3-.
OK:
Resistance: 5.0 - 5.6

at 20

C (68

F)

NG(C)

Go to step 7

3

INSPECT TRANSMISSION WIRE(S4/SR)

(a)

Measure resistance between terminal S4 and body
ground.
OK:
Resistance: 11 - 15

at 20

C (68

F)

NG(A)

Go to step 8

(b)

Measure resistance between terminal SR and body
ground.
OK:
Resistance: 11 - 15

at 20

C (68

F)

NG(B)

Go to step 9

OK

4

CHECK HARNESS AND CONNECTOR(TRANSMISSION WIRE-ECM)

(a)

Connect the 2 transmission connectors to the transaxle.

(b)

Disconnect the connector from the ECM.

(c)

Measure the resistance between terminals.
OK:
Resistance:
SL1+ - SL1-: 5.0 - 5.6

at 20

C (68

F)

SL2+ - SL2-: 5.0 - 5.6

at 20

C (68

F)

SL3+ - SL3-: 5.0 - 5.6

at 20

C (68

F)

S4 - E1: 11 - 15

at 20

C (68

F)

SR - E1: 11 - 15

at 20

C (68

F)

NG

REPAIR OR REPLACE HARNESS OR
CONNECTOR(See page

01-31

)

OK

CHECK AND REPLACE ECM(See page

01-31

)

5

INSPECT SHIFT SOLENOID VALVE SL1

(a)

Remove the shift solenoid valve SL1.

(b)

Measure the resistance between terminals.
OK:
Resistance: 5.0 - 5.6

at 20

°

C (68

°

F)

(c)

Connect the positive (+) lead with a 21 W bulb to terminal
2 and the negative (-) lead to terminal 1 of the solenoid
valve connector, then check the movement of the valve.
OK:
The solenoid makes an operating noise.

NG

REPLACE SHIFT SOLENOID VALVE SL1

OK

REPAIR OR REPLACE TRANSMISSION WIRE(See page

01-31

)

6

INSPECT SHIFT SOLENOID VALVE SL2

(a)

Remove the shift solenoid valve SL2.

(b)

Measure the resistance between terminals.
OK:
Resistance: 5.0 - 5.6

at 20

°

C (68

°

F)

(c)

Connect the positive (+) lead with a 21 W bulb to terminal
2 and the negative (-) lead to terminal 1 of the solenoid
valve connector, then check the movement of the valve.
OK:
The solenoid makes an operating noise.

NG

REPLACE SHIFT SOLENOID VALVE SL2

OK

REPAIR OR REPLACE TRANSMISSION WIRE(See page

01-31

)
